PlayerUnknown’s Battlegrounds Receiving War Mode On Xbox One Later This Year

Xbox One players will be able to play PUBG's War Mode very soon.

Posted By | On 11th, Jun. 2018

PlayerUnknown’s Battlegrounds is best known, of course, for its battle royale mode, which almost pioneered the genre (though Fortnite has definitely stolen the spotlight in recent months). That said, PUBG has more to offer as well. More specifically, PC players have been enjoying the game’s War Mode for some time now.

At Microsoft’s E3 press event earlier today, it was announced that the game’s Xbox One version will also be updated with the War Mode some time in Winter of 2018- though a more specific release timing for the content in question wasn’t mentioned. Meanwhile, it was also announced that the third PUBG map, called Sanhok, is going to be out this Summer (again, a more specific release date wasn’t mentioned).

All this was, of course, announced via a new trailer, which also showed as bunch of gameplay footage- though for a game that’s been out for months (or over a year, if you’re a PC player), that shouldn’t really matter that much. Take a look anyway.
